Komunikator p2p

0

Chciałbym napisać prosty, LANowy komunikator. Zastanawiam się nad jednym:
Wszystkie przykłady w internecie 'WCF p2p communicator' działają tak, że cokolwiek się napisze, każdy uczestnik czatu może to odczytać. Pytanie co zrobić, aby móc pisać tylko do wybranego peera?
Jedyne co przychodzi mi do głowy, to wysyłając wiadomość, umieścić w niej informację od kogo wyszła i do kogo powinna dojść. I wtedy, gdy otrzymam wiadomość, która jest zaadresowana do kogoś innego, ignoruję ją. Takie rozwiązanie spowodowałoby jednak, że wszystkie prywatne wiadomości latałyby po wszystkich peerach - co miałoby bardzo negatywny wpływ na wydajność sieci i programu.
Czy dobrze myślę? Czy to jest dobre rozwiązanie? Może ktoś zaproponować lepsze?

0

Na moje oko, to serwer powinien mieć listę wszystkich klientów i ich adresów IP, i przesyłać dane tylko między zainteresowanymi, a nie do wszystkich.

1 użytkowników online, w tym zalogowanych: 0, gości: 1